What We
Believe

The Trinity

We believe in one GOD, eternally existing in three persons: Father, Son, and Holy Spirit.  Matthew 28:19, Genesis 1:26

The Lord Jesus Christ

We believe that Jesus Christ was begotten by the Holy Spirit, and born of the virgin Mary, and is true God and true man. 

Luke 1:26-38, Hebrews 4:14-16.

The Word of God

We believe the Scriptures, the 66 books containing both of the old and new testaments, to be verbally inspired of God and inerrant in the original writings and that they are the supreme and final authority in faith and life. 

II Peter 1:21

Man

We believe that man was created in the image of God, that he sinned and thereby incurred not only physical death but also spiritual death, which is separation from God and that all human beings are born with a sinful nature.  Isaiah 53:6, Romans 5:12-21

Salvation through Christ's Death and Resurrection

We believe that the Lord Jesus Christ died for our sins according to the Scriptures as a representative and substitutionary sacrifice and that all who believe in Him are justified on the grounds of His shed blood. 

Romans 5:9; 2 Corinthians 5:21

We believe in the resurrection of the crucified body of our Lord, in His ascension into Heaven, and in His present life there for us as High priest and Advocate.  I Corinthians 15:1-4; Acts 1:9; I John 2:1

We believe that all who receive by faith the Lord Jesus Christ are born again of the Holy Spirit and thereby become children of God.  

John 3:5,6; John 1:12

The Last Things

We believe in the bodily resurrection of the just and the unjust, the everlasting felicity of the saved, and the everlasting conscious suffering of the lost.  John 6:39-40; I Corinthians 15:22-24; Revelation 20:12-15

The Lord's Supper

We believe that the Lord’s Supper is a provision of the bread and the cup representing Christ’s broken body and shed blood partaken of by believers assembled for that purpose in commemoration of the death of their Lord. 

I Corinthians 11:23-24

Baptism

We believe that Christian Baptism is the immersion in water of a believer in the name of the Father, and the Son, and the Holy Spirit showing forth in a solemn and beautiful emblem our union with the crucified, buried and risen Savior.  Matthew 28:19; Romans 6:3-5
